Amy M. McGrath-Henderson (born 1975) is an American former Marine fighter pilot and political candidate. She was the first female Marine Corps pilot to fly the F/A-18 on a combat mission. McGrath served for 20 years in the Marine Corps during which time she flew 89 combat missions bombing al Qaeda and the Taliban. In 2016, she was inducted into the Aviation Museum of Kentucky's Hall of Fame and her military story is described in Band of Sisters: American Women at War in Iraq.

McGrath was the Democratic nominee for Kentucky's 6th congressional district in the 2018 election, narrowly losing to Republican incumbent Andy Barr.
